Overview [{$pagename}] (MCC) is a four-[digit] [Code], listed in [ISO 18245] for retail [financial] services, issued by the [Payment Network] (Visa, Mastercard, Discover, American Express) assign to every [Merchant] that applies to accept [Payment Cards] during [Enrollment]. [{$pagename}] is based on the __predominant business activity__ of the [merchant] and are often never changed even though the [Merchant] changes their [Line Of Business]. [{$pagename}] may be different for the different [Payment Networks]. [{$pagename}] is used for [Classification]: * to determine the [Interchange Fee] paid by the [merchant], with riskier lines of business paying higher fees. * by [Payment Network] companies to offer cash back rewards or reward points, for spending in specific categories * by [Payment Network] to define rules and restrictions for card transactions (for example, Automated Fuel Dispensers (MCC 5542) have specific rules for [authorization] and clearing messages). * in the [United States], to determine whether a payment is primarily for “services”, which needs to be reported by the payor to the [Internal Revenue Service] for tax purposes, or for “merchandise”, which does not.[2] !!
